Canadian Government to Help Fund Road Upgrades Near CPR's Calgary Intermodal Facility

Calgary Alberta - The Canadian government will provide up to $34.5 million to help the city of Calgary, Alberta, fund improvements to a main road leading to Canadian Pacific Railway's intermodal yard.
 
The project calls for grade separating CPR's line and the Western Headwaters Canal, and widening the road from two lanes to either four or six lanes.
 
The upgraded road will provide trucks a more efficient and safer approach to the yard, Canadian officials said in a prepared statement.
 
The project is part of the Asia-Pacific Gateway and Corridor Initiative.
 
The government will provide funds from the $2.1 billion Gateways and Border Crossings Fund, which was established to help improve the flow of goods between Canada and other nations.
